无论是个人照片、视频、文档,还是企业级的项目资料、客户信息,数据的安全存储与高效访问成为我们日益关注的焦点
随着云计算技术的普及,公有云和私有云的概念逐渐进入大众视野
公有云如AWS、Azure、阿里云等,提供了便捷、可扩展的云服务,但数据安全和隐私保护始终是悬在头顶的一把剑
相比之下,私有云因其数据独享、高度可控的特点,受到越来越多企业和个人的青睐
那么,作为日常使用的电脑,能否被改造成一个私有云呢?答案是肯定的,而且操作并不复杂
本文将深入探讨电脑作为私有云的可行性、优势、搭建步骤及注意事项,帮助你打造一个属于自己的私有云存储解决方案
一、电脑作为私有云的可行性分析 1.硬件基础:现代个人电脑普遍配备了足够的计算能力和存储空间,无论是台式机还是笔记本电脑,都足以支撑一个小型私有云的运行
一块大容量硬盘或SSD,加上一个稳定的网络连接,就是构建私有云的基本条件
2.软件支持:市面上有许多开源或商业化的私有云软件,如Nextcloud、OwnCloud、Seafile等,它们提供了文件共享、同步、版本控制等功能,且易于安装配置在Windows、Linux或macOS系统上
3.成本效益:相比购买专业的私有云存储设备或订阅公有云服务,利用现有电脑资源搭建私有云成本更低,尤其是对于个人和小型企业而言,这是一种经济实惠的选择
4.数据安全与隐私:将数据存储在自家电脑上,意味着你对数据拥有完全的控制权,无需担心第三方云服务提供商的数据泄露风险
同时,通过加密传输和访问控制,可以进一步增强数据安全性
二、电脑私有云的优势 1.数据自主可控:私有云的最大优势在于数据的自主性和可控性
你可以决定数据的存储位置、访问权限和备份策略,确保数据的私密性和安全性
2.高性能访问:相比依赖互联网连接的公有云,本地私有云在访问速度上具有显著优势,特别是对于大文件传输和实时协作场景,私有云能提供更加流畅的体验
3.灵活性与可扩展性:虽然基于电脑的私有云在规模上可能无法与大型数据中心相比,但通过添加外部硬盘、升级硬件配置或采用集群方案,依然可以实现一定程度的扩展
4.跨平台同步:大多数私有云软件都支持跨平台访问,无论是手机、平板还是其他电脑,只要能上网,就能随时随地访问和管理你的云存储空间
三、搭建电脑私有云的步骤 1.准备硬件与软件: - 确保电脑操作系统是最新的,以减少安全风险
- 选择一款私有云软件,根据个人偏好和需求,Nextcloud因其功能丰富、社区活跃而广受好评
- 检查网络连接稳定性,确保有足够的带宽支持数据传输
2.安装私有云软件: - 下载并安装选定的私有云软件,如Nextcloud
- 在安装过程中,根据向导配置数据库(可以选择MySQL、PostgreSQL等)、Web服务器(如Apache或Nginx)和PHP环境
- 完成安装后,通过浏览器访问本地服务器地址,进行初始化设置,包括创建管理员账户、配置邮件通知等
3.配置存储与权限: - 在私有云管理界面,设置数据存储路径,可以是本地硬盘的某个目录,也可以是网络附加存储(NAS)设备
- 创建用户账户,为每个用户分配不同的访问权限,确保数据的安全访问
- 启用SSL/TLS加密,保护数据传输过程中的安全
4.端口转发与远程访问: - 如果需要在外网访问私有云,需要在路由器上设置端口转发,将外部请求转发到私有云的服务器上
- 使用动态域名服务(DDNS)或固定IP地址,确保远程访问的稳定性
- 注意,开放端口可能带来安全风险,务必配置防火墙规则,限制访问来源,并定期检查系统日志
5.备份与恢复计划: - 制定数据备份策略,定期将私有云数据备份到外部硬盘或另一台电脑上,以防本地数据丢失
- 了解并测试数据恢复流程,确保在需要时能够迅速恢复数据
四、注意事项与维护建议 1.安全更新:定期更新操作系统、Web服务器、数据库和私有云软件,以修复已知的安全漏洞
2.密码策略:使用强密码,并定期更换,同时启用双因素认证,增加账户安全性
3.监控与日志:启用系统监控,定期检查服务器日志,及时发现并处理异常访问尝试
4.性能优化:根据使用情况调整资源分配,如增加内存、优化数据库查询等,提升私有云性能
5.数据合规性:了解并遵守所在地区的数据保护法律法规,确保数据处理的合法性和合规性
五、结语 综上所述,将个人电脑改造成私有云是完全可行的,不仅能够满足个人和小型企业对于数据安全、隐私保护和高效访问的需求,还能在一定程度上节省成本
通过合理的规划、配置与维护,电脑私有云能够成为一个可靠、高效的数据存储和共享平台
当然,随着技术的发展和需求的增长,未来可能会有更多专业的私有云解决方案涌现,但基于现有电脑资源的私有云搭建,无疑是一个值得尝试的起点
在这个数字化时代,掌握数据,就是掌握未来